Suggest a reason why the veins of a bodybuilder ""pop out"" more than a person who does not lift weights. Why don’t we see arteries ""pop out""?

Explanation:

A bodybuilder has comparatively lower body fat than an average person who does not lifts. This in turn means a thinner skin that promotes Vascularity,

Vascularity is the state of having prominent, visible and popping veins.
